Luma Labs

Luma Labs is a video tool that allows you to turn a video on your phone into a fully interactive, highly immersive experience. It uses neural Radiance Fields or Nerfs and has a new feature called interactive scenes that uses gsh and splatter. The interactive scenes have a small file size, so you can embed them anywhere or send them to a friend for them to explore. There are endless uses for this in retail, real estate, travel, and creative uses as well. You can download the free app on your phone and check out uploads from other users for inspiration.

Genie

Genie is a text-to-3D model that's free right now during the research phase. It's operated in the Luma Discord server in any of these Genie channels using the in command. Just add your prompt, and it generates incredibly fast and is by far the best version of text to 3D I've come across in terms of quality and time. There are people rigging entire scenes with this that look amazing.

Perplexity

Perplexity is a fine-tuned chat GPT that's basically an interactive search assistant that you can ask anything. It uses up-to-date information and browses the web across multiple sources and comes back with concise answers almost instantly. It shows you what sources it used, and you can click through to the article for further reading. I use the mobile app most and find myself using it over Google most of the time for question-based searches.

Siace

Siace is the easiest way to find, learn, and understand any research paper. It's similar to Perplexity, but it only cites research papers, not websites or the overall internet. It's geared towards people that are students or researchers, but it's great for anyone that has questions in the realm of science that wants research back answers. You can ask any question, and it will give you insight from the top five papers up at the top with citations. You can click through to read the paper and then more relevant papers below. You can also chat with the copile about the answers you received.

Google Search Generative Experience

Google's new search generative experience is an experimental feature that you can turn on to use AI in search. It pops up on the top of your search and gives a concise summary of some answers with sources on the side. You can expand it to read more and ask follow-up questions. It can be really helpful in a lot of situations.

Ideogram

Ideogram is great with text-based designs, logos, and illustrations. It's not going to be as good as the others for things like photo realism or getting really specific with what you want. When you type your prompt, it will pop up with a bunch of different styles you can choose from, or you can just direct it with your prompt.

Stable Diffusion

Stable Diffusion is open source, uncensored, and amazing. If you have a capable computer, you can install it locally and use it completely free. Other platforms have been built on top that utilize Stable Diffusion and make it much easier to use.

Playground AI

Playground AI is a canvas-based platform where you have a full workspace to move around and create in. It looks intimidating at first, but it's really powerful. There are tons and tons of other features in here, and if you want to learn, a really good resource is their YouTube channel.

Upscaling and Restoration

Replicate has a full suite of image restoration and upscalers. Upscaling is under super resolution, and you'll find a bunch of models for different needs. Upscale spelled with a y.org is free open-source software you can download, and it has multiple options to choose from for different types of upscaling.
